Aristocracies refer to a class of ruling elites distinguished by their social status, wealth, and power. There are several synonyms for aristocracies, which can be used interchangeably in various contexts. One such synonym is nobility, which denotes a high-ranking social class known for its hereditary titles and privileges, often linked to land ownership. Another synonym is gentry, which represents a wealthier and more respected section of society distinguished by birth and education. The term oligarchies can also be used to describe aristocracies, indicating a small group of individuals having control over a country or an organization. Regardless of the synonym used, aristocratic societies have long existed and continue to play a significant role in the world today.
